Formula

  • r = annual rate / 12 / 100
  • n = tenure in years × 12
  • EMI = P × r × (1 + r)ⁿ / [(1 + r)ⁿ − 1]
  • Total payment = EMI × n
  • Total interest = Total payment − P

A reducing-balance loan charges interest only on the outstanding principal. The EMI is the constant payment that exactly retires the loan over n months — it is the future-value-of-annuity formula rearranged for the payment. Early instalments are mostly interest because the balance is high; as the balance falls, the principal share of each EMI rises, which is why the amortisation schedule below is steeply skewed.

Step-by-step calculation

  1. Monthly rate

    8.75 / 12 / 100

    0.007292

  2. Number of instalments

    20 × 12

    240

  3. Growth factor (1 + r)ⁿ

    (1 + 0.007292)^240

    5.7182

  4. EMI

    P·r·(1+r)ⁿ / ((1+r)ⁿ − 1)

    ₹22,092.77

  5. Total payment

    22,093 × 240

    ₹5,302,264.25

  6. Total interest

    5,302,264 − 2,500,000

    ₹2,802,264.25

Assumptions

  • Interest is compounded monthly on the reducing balance.
  • The rate stays fixed for the whole tenure (floating loans reprice with the benchmark).
  • The first EMI falls one month after disbursal; no moratorium.
  • Insurance, GST on fees and late-payment charges are excluded unless entered.

Tips

  • Shortening the tenure cuts total interest far more than shaving the rate by a few basis points.
  • One extra EMI a year on a 20-year home loan typically removes 3–4 years of payments.
  • Compare lenders on APR (rate plus fees), not the headline rate.

Warnings

  • Floating-rate loans keep the EMI fixed and extend the tenure when the benchmark rises — confirm which lever your lender moves.
  • Prepayment penalties may apply on fixed-rate and non-individual loans.

Frequently asked questions

Why is the early EMI almost all interest?

Interest each month is balance × monthly rate. In month one the balance is the full principal, so interest dominates. The principal component grows geometrically at (1 + r) each month.

Does a longer tenure reduce cost?

No. It reduces the monthly outflow but increases total interest, often substantially — compare the total-interest figure across tenures before choosing.

How is APR different from the interest rate?

APR folds processing fees and mandatory charges into an effective annual cost, so it is the honest basis for comparing two loan offers.
